Role: Member Services Representative - Open Enrollment
Time frame for completion: 40 hours/week on-site in Concord, CA (M-F 8 AM-5 PM PST) *Description* Description of work to be performed: Duties and Responsibilities: *Performs various duties and responsibilities of Member Services Assistant and Member Services Assistant Lead. *Communicates via telephone, in person and written correspondence, answers questions regarding the Plans' Benefits, eligibility, claims processing and claims appeal *Obtains all pertinent information to determine specific purpose of call and/or walk-in. *Writes an eligibility appeal, sick leave and/or basic medical appeal if necessary. *Initiates and prepares correspondence and other documentation to resolve questions and provide information to members and others in accordance with Plans' rules, regulations, and practices. *Initiates and reviews various applications, notices, forms, certifications, self-payments, COBRA, stop payments, clear claim notices. *Identifies and corrects information on Computer system and/or refers to appropriate staff for correction. *Determines eligibility in accordance with Plan rules and resolves eligibility issues and questions. Confirms or denies coverage based on eligibility rules of the member's plan. *Maintains appropriate documentation of all calls & walk-ins. *Handles walk-ins in a courteous and professional manner. *Discerns needs and verifies forms from a walk-in and refers to appropriate personnel based on needs. *Acts as liaison between member and provider to communicate plan benefits and facilitate claims processing. *Calculates sick leave banks. *Refers calls, members, union locals, and others to appropriate department. *Assists with special projects as requested. Specified productivity speed/number of tasks/amount of material: Sample of Job Duties: *Answering calls with Headset *HIPAA Checks/Survey Offered *Reference the Requirements based on Plan Level *Kaiser Telephonic HIPAA *Provider Eligibility calls *Comprehend Enrollment Requirements/Options *Carrier Changes *Dependent Coverage Changes *Other Insurance Information Updates *Dependent Documentation (Birth Certifications/Marriage Certifications/Authorization to Deduct Form/Tax Form or Re-Occurring Household Bills) *Comprehend Wellness Step Requirements/Options *HCP Agreement *Health Risk Questionnaire (HRQ) *Biometrics PPO vs HMO Members along with Vaccination Card Requirements All items will be tracked in the member's profile. *Skills* Call center, Data entry, Customer support, Inbound call, Microsoft office, open enrollment, Insurance, Customer service, Health care, Customer service call center, benefits verification, claims submission *Top Skills Details* Call center,Data entry,Customer support,Inbound call,Microsoft office,open enrollment *Additional Skills & Qualifications* *High school diploma *Strong communication skills and knowledge of grammar, spelling and simple mathematical functions like percentages, ratios, etc. *Experience Level* Entry Level *Pay and Benefits* The pay range for this position is $22.00 - $32.00/hr.
